Introduction to U Part Wigs
u part wig human hair brown have gained significant popularity in recent years, thanks in part to their versatility and ease of wear. Unlike traditional wigs that cover the entire head, u part wigs are designed with a unique opening shaped like the letter ‘U’. This feature allows the wearer to leave out a portion of their natural hair, particularly at the crown and front, which facilitates a more natural look. This distinctive design not only enhances the wig’s realism but also accommodates various hairstyles and textures.
One of the most compelling aspects of u part wigs is their capacity to blend seamlessly with natural hair, especially when crafted from high-quality human hair. The u part wig human hair brown is particularly sought after, as it closely mirrors the softness and luster of natural brown hair. By choosing a wig in a shade that closely resembles one’s own hair color, individuals can create a harmonious appearance and a convincing illusion of length or volume.
When comparing u part wigs to other wig styles, such as lace front wigs or full lace wigs, one cannot overlook the ease of application. U part wigs allow for quick adjustments and can be easily secured with combs or clips. Additionally, they require less maintenance compared to full wigs since only a portion of the natural hair is covered. This makes them ideal for those who desire a protective style while allowing their hair to breathe and maintain its health.

Maintenance and Care for U Part Wig Human Hair Brown
To ensure that your u part wig human hair brown remains in optimal condition, proper maintenance and care are paramount. Regular washing and conditioning are essential, but it is crucial to follow specific guidelines to avoid damage. Begin by using a sulfate-free shampoo, as sulfates can strip the hair of its natural oils, leading to dryness and brittleness. Therefore, it’s advisable to wash your wig every 10 to 14 days, depending on usage. When washing, gently detangle the strands with a wide-tooth comb and apply shampoo using a downward motion, which helps maintain the wig’s natural flow.
Conditioning is equally important for maintaining the softness and shine of your u part wig human hair brown. After shampooing, apply a hydrating conditioner, focusing particularly on the ends, where the hair is most prone to damage. Allow the conditioner to sit for a few minutes before rinsing thoroughly to ensure that all residue is removed.
After washing, it is vital to properly dry and store your wig. Lay the wig flat on a towel to absorb excess water, avoiding twisting or wringing as this can lead to tangles. Once most of the moisture has evaporated, hang the wig on a wig stand or mannequin head to air dry completely. Never use heat to dry your u part wig human hair brown, as this can cause irreversible damage.
Additionally, when you are not wearing your wig, store it in a cool, dry place, preferably in a silk or satin bag to prevent tangling and friction. It is also advisable to keep it away from direct sunlight to prevent fading. Regular trimming can help to remove split ends and maintain the style of the wig, ensuring that it continues to look fresh and vibrant. By incorporating these maintenance strategies, you can prolong the lifespan of your u part wig human hair brown while ensuring it retains its beauty and functionality.
